Written Response Guidelines and Rubric
Overview
In this assignment, you will continue working with the text you chose for the project by summarizing, quoting, paraphrasing, and using in-text citations. Specifically, this assignment will prepare you to summarize details of the text that are relevant to the core idea and support your analysis of the core idea with evidence from the text. You will continue to develop these skills in future assignments as you prepare to complete your project.
Directions
For this assignment, you will first write a brief summary of the text. Next, you will choose a sentence from the text and incorporate it as a quote in an originally crafted sentence. Then, you will take the same sentence and incorporate it as a paraphrase. Be sure to use in-text citations throughout the assignment. Complete this assignment using the template linked in the What to Submit section.
Specifically, you must address the following:
1.    Write a brief summary of the text chosen for the project.
A.   Your summary should be three or four sentences long.
2.    Choose one sentence from the text and incorporate it as a quote in an original sentence.
3.    Take the same sentence from the text and incorporate it as a paraphrase in an original sentence.
4.    Use in-text citations throughout the assignment to properly cite the writer’s ideas according to APA or MLA standards.
A.   Use either APA or MLA standards to properly cite the writer’s ideas in your summary as well as in the sentences where you quoted and paraphrased the writer’s work.
